Calories in Breaded Squid Rings

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(113.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 270.1
  • Total Fat 13.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 3.5 g
  • Cholesterol 105.1 mg
  • Sodium 649.8 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 26.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 1.0 g
  • Sugars 0.0 g
  • Protein 10.0 g

📋 Nutrition Summary

With 270.1 calories per serving (1 Serving (113.0g)), Breaded Squid Rings is a moderately calorie-dense food worth tracking if you're managing your intake. The majority of its calories come from fat (13.0g, 44.8% of calories), including 3.5g of saturated fat. One thing to note: a single serving contains 649.8mg of sodium (28% of the daily recommended limit), which is significant if you're watching your salt intake.

📝 Ingredients

Todarodes Squid Rings, Wheat Flour, Corn Starch, Modified Corn Starch, Wheat Protein, Salt, Black Pepper, Disodium Dihydrogen Pyrophosphate, Sodium Bicarbonate, Guar Gum, Yeast, Water

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Breaded Squid Rings

Is Breaded Squid Rings good for weight loss?

Breaded squid rings are moderately high in calories at 270 per 113g serving, making portion control important for weight loss. The 10g of protein per serving does help with satiety, though the 26g of carbs and 13g of fat mean this isn't the leanest choice.

Is Breaded Squid Rings good for muscle building?

With 10g of protein per serving, these provide a modest amount to support muscle recovery, though you'd need to eat a larger portion or combine them with other protein sources for a more substantial post-workout meal.

Is Breaded Squid Rings good post-workout fuel?

These could work as a post-workout snack thanks to the protein and carbs, but they're not ideal since the carbs come mainly from refined breading rather than whole grains, and the fat content may slow digestion.

Is Breaded Squid Rings heart-healthy?

The high sodium is a concern for heart health, and the saturated fat at 3.5g per serving adds up quickly if you eat multiple servings. The cholesterol content at 105mg is moderate but worth considering as part of your overall diet.

What should I watch out for with Breaded Squid Rings?

The sodium content at 650mg per serving is notably high—that's nearly 30% of the daily limit—so be mindful if you're watching salt intake. The breading adds significant carbs and fat while the fiber content is minimal at just 1g.
